Why Consider Conservatory Refurbishment?
Conservatories serve as versatile spaces for relaxation, dining, and even working from home. However, the list below factors typically trigger homeowners to consider refurbishment:
Aesthetic Update: Trends in home design evolve often. An out-of-date conservatory style can diminish the general worth of a home and might no longer meet the house owner's design preferences.
Functionality: A conservatory needs to improve living spaces. As needs alter— whether a family grows, or a new hobby takes shape— a refurbishment can create a location more suited to contemporary lifestyles.
Energy Efficiency: Older conservatories might not be equipped with contemporary insulation or glazing technology, causing temperature variations and higher energy costs. Refurbishing can address this issue, making the conservatory more sustainable and cost-effective.
Repair and Maintenance Needs: Wear and tear are inescapable. If components like roofing, windows, or doors are damaged or overly aged, a refurbishment provides an opportunity for needed repairs.
Improved Resale Value: Potential purchasers are typically brought in to homes with well-kept and aesthetically attractive conservatories. Purchasing refurbishment can boost the home's marketability.
Actions to Refurbishing a Conservatory
Refurbishing a conservatory is a multi-faceted process needing thoughtful planning. Here are essential steps homeowners must consider:
1. Evaluating the Current State
Before diving into the refurbishment procedure, it's essential to assess the condition of the conservatory. This evaluation needs to cover:
- Structural stability of the framework
- State of the glazing and roof
- Condition of associated components such as doors and heating
- Quality of insulation
2. Specifying the Purpose
Picking the primary function of the conservatory post-refurbishment can assist form the design choices. Think about these options:
- A relaxation area with comfortable seating
- A hobby or craft room
- An outside dining area
- A green area for plants and foliage
3. Setting a Budget
Every refurbishment needs to start with a budget. Elements to think about include:
- Materials utilized for construction and decoration
- Furnishings and fixtures
- Labor costs (if contracting professional help)
- Permits or structural modifications
4. Selecting Design Elements
The visual aspects of the refurbishment are vital. Consider including:
- Modern glazing alternatives for energy effectiveness and design
- Color schemes that match the main home
- Floor covering that is both long lasting and visually enticing
- Lighting elements to boost the atmosphere
5. Hiring Professionals or DIY
Depending upon the task's scope and the house owner's abilities, they may select:
- Hiring Professionals: An experienced team can supply insights, conserve time, and possibly prevent costly errors.
- Do It Yourself: For minor refurbishments such as decorating or simple renovations, a DIY method can be both gratifying and cost-efficient.
6. Obtaining Necessary Permits

Frequently Asked Questions about Conservatory Refurbishment
Q1: How long does a common conservatory refurbishment take?A: The period varies considerably based on the scope of work. Small updates might take a couple of days, while thorough repairs can last a number of weeks.
Q2: Do I require planning approval for a conservatory refurbishment?A: It depends on the extent of the work. If you are changing the structure substantially, it's best to check with regional authorities relating to preparation consents.
Q3: What is the average cost of refurbishing a conservatory?A: Costs vary extensively based upon aspects such as size, materials, and design. On average, property owners can expect to spend anywhere from ₤ 5,000 to ₤ 20,000 or more.
Q4: Can I refurbish my conservatory on a budget?A: Yes, by preparing meticulously, focusing on important changes, and exploring cost-effective products and DIY options, an effective refurbishment can be attained within financial constraints.
Q5: Is it possible to increase the size of my conservatory during refurbishment?A: Yes, increasing the size is a typical refurbishment enhancement. However, structural modifications might require planning approvals and professional input.
